About

Dr. James Spears, MD is a Hematology Specialist in Sellersville, PA and has 22 years experience. They graduated from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ine. They currently practice at Practice and are affiliated with Doylestown Hospital, Grand View Health and St. Luke’s Quakertown Campus. Dr. Spears has experience treating conditions like Anemia, Venous Embolism and Thrombosis and Deep Vein Thrombosis (DVT) among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Spears received an average rating of 4.8/5 from patients and has been reviewed 40 times. Their office accepts new patients and telehealth appointments. Dr. Spears is board certified in Medical Oncology and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
